NCA stands for the National Crime Agency. It is a highly influential group in the field of law enforcement, responsible for overseeing competitions among various institutions. Understanding Canadian IRCC Processing Times Navigating the world of Canadian immigration can be a challenging process. One crucial aspect to factor i… Read More